Amplified insert assembly: an optimized approach to standard assembly of BioBrick<sup>TM</sup> genetic circuits
<p>Abstract</p> <p>A modified BioBrick™ assembly method was developed with higher fidelity than current protocols. The method utilizes a PCR reaction with a standard primer set to amplify the inserted part. Background colonies are reduced by a combination of dephosphorylation and d...
